Kim Kardashian’s brand clarifies position amid drug trafficking controversy

Kim Kardashian’s brand SKIMS denied any involvement in an 8.4 million USD cocaine trafficking case after drugs were discovered in a truck carrying legitimate merchandise. Authorities confirmed the company had no knowledge or connection to the smuggling operation

Reality star and businesswoman Kim Kardashian has found her shapewear brand SKIMS at the centre of an unexpected controversy after a drug trafficking case in the United Kingdom drew global attention. The company recently issued a public statement distancing itself from an USD 8.4 million cocaine smuggling operation in which a truck carrying SKIMS merchandise was allegedly used to transport illegal drugs.
Kim Kardashian's SKIMS falls in a drug scandal
According to reports from the UK’s National Crime Agency (NCA), a Polish truck driver named Jakub Jan Konkel was arrested after border officials discovered approximately 90 kilograms of cocaine hidden inside a specially modified compartment of a truck transporting legitimate SKIMS clothing shipments. Authorities reportedly intercepted the vehicle at the Port of Harwich in Essex after it arrived via ferry from the Netherlands.
